✅ Part 1: Rank Where It Matters (Local SEO)

Why it works:
70% of people looking for local services start on Google (even in the AI era). And they trust what they find in the map pack (those top 3 listings you see near the map).

How to do it:

  • Claim and fully fill out your Google Business Profile

  • Get consistent 5-star reviews (ask every happy customer)

  • Add photos, services, and weekly posts

  • Make sure your Name, Address, Phone (NAP) is consistent across all directories (Yelp, Angi, BBB, Mapquest (yes, that Mapquest), etc.)

Pro tip: Search “[your service] near me” and see who ranks. Study what they’re doing right.

You’ll see Local Service Ads at the top, and local SEO results underneath. Both are extremely effective, but with different costs / benefits.

✅ Part 2: Use Ads That Target Intent

Why it works:
Most local businesses waste money on broad ads that don’t convert. The magic happens when you reach people actively searching for what you do.

How to do it:

  • Start with Google Search Ads targeting specific terms like:

    • “emergency plumber in [city]”

    • “best [service] near me”

  • Use call-only ads if your leads come in by phone

  • Set up conversion tracking (calls, forms, bookings)

Pro tip: Don’t send ad traffic to your homepage. Create a specific landing page for each service you advertise.

Traditional Google Ads are cheaper than LSAs and high converting (if done right)

✅ Part 3: Build Pages That Convert

Why it works:
Your website is your storefront. If it’s slow, confusing, or generic, you’re losing leads. Fast.

How to do it:

  • Use one clear call to action (not 6)

  • Add trust signals: reviews, certifications, testimonials

  • Cut the fluff—explain what you do, who it’s for, and why it’s better

  • Make mobile speed a priority (use PageSpeed Insights to test yours)

Pro tip: Use a scheduling tool (like Calendly or Square Appointments) to make it easy for people to take the next step.

🛠 Bonus: Small Tweaks That Make a Big Impact

  • Add a live chat or chatbot to your site

  • Follow up with every missed call

  • Text leads within 5 minutes—response rates go way up

  • Use a simple CRM to keep track of every lead
